Embodiment 1

[0023] An insulating pressure-sensitive adhesive tape for high-voltage cable joints, made of the following raw materials in parts by weight: 100 parts of neoprene rubber, 15 parts of high molecular weight polyisobutylene, 8 parts of polybutadiene rubber, 10 parts of carbon five petroleum resin, hydrogenated carbon five 15 parts of petroleum resin, 10 parts of rosin pentaerythritol ester, 15 parts of terpene resin, 10 parts of pine tar, 2 parts of stearic acid, 0.4 parts of 1,3-diethylthiourea, 2 parts of anti-aging agent, 4 parts of zinc oxide, 80 parts of carbon fiber, 1 part of antioxidant, 0.3 part of coloring agent.

[0024] The above-mentioned production method comprises the following steps:

[0025] (1) Material preparation: Weigh each raw material by weight, grind the weighed zinc oxide and colorant with a grinder, and set aside;

Abstract

The invention discloses an insulated pressure-sensitive adhesive tape for high-voltage cable joints and a preparation method thereof. The insulated pressure-sensitive adhesive tape for high-voltage cable joints is prepared from the following raw materials in parts by weight: 100 parts of neoprene, 15-25 parts of high molecular weight polyisobutylene, 8-12 parts of polybutadiene rubber, 10-30 parts of C5 petroleum resin, 15-45 parts of hydrogenated C5 petroleum resin, 10-30 parts of pentalyn, 15-35 parts of terpine resin, 10-20 parts of pine tar oil, 2-6 parts of stearic acid, 0.4-0.8 part of 1,3-diethyl thiourea, 2-4 parts of anti-aging agent, 4-6 parts of zinc oxide, 80-100 parts of carbon fiber, 1-3 parts of antioxidant and 0.3-0.5 part of colorant. The invention also provides the preparation method of the insulated pressure-sensitive adhesive tape. The insulated pressure-sensitive adhesive tape for high-voltage cable joints has the following beneficial effects of improving the insulation and ageing resistance, and increasing the initial adhesive strength, peel strength and holding power of the adhesive tape.

technical field [0001] The invention relates to a pressure-sensitive adhesive tape and a manufacturing method thereof, in particular to an insulating pressure-sensitive adhesive tape for high-voltage cable joints and a manufacturing method thereof. Background technique [0002] In the construction and erection of high-voltage cables with long circuits, two or more sections of cables must be connected with cable joints to improve the electric field at the ends of the two cables and reduce the induced electromotive force of the metal sheath. Among them, the protection of cable joints is an important part of cable protection, and it is the key work to avoid or reduce cable operation failures. [0003] At present, the protection of high-voltage cable joints mostly adopts the method of hot melting.
